Eligibility Criteria
- The Internship is open to enrolled Undergraduate University students.
- The Students can apply from any academic background.
- A minimum of a predicted 2:2 degree, or equivalent, in any subject.
- Skills in Microsoft 365 programs.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- Initiative-driven and a change agent
- Excellent interpersonal skills
How to Apply?
- Check your eligibility: you must be a university student returning after the summer, with a predicted minimum 2:2 degree (or equivalent) in any subject, and be able to work in the UK for the full internship.
- Prepare your CV and personal statement, highlighting your skills, experiences, and why you want to join British Airways.
- Submit your application online via the official British Airways careers page before 19th November 2025.
- Complete a video interview if shortlisted, preparing by reviewing the company and practicing common interview questions.
- Attend the face-to-face Assessment Centre if selected, participating in activities, group exercises, and discussions to showcase your skills.
- Receive your internship offer and confirm your acceptance to secure your place for the 10-week summer internship starting June 2026.

What is the recruitment process for the British Airways Summer Internship 2026?
The process includes submitting an online application, completing a video interview if shortlisted, and attending a face-to-face Assessment Centre in December. Each stage assesses skills, potential, and suitability for the internship.
Can international students apply for the British Airways Summer Internship 2026?
Yes, applicants must be able to demonstrate the right to work in the UK for the full 10-week internship. Visa sponsorship is not offered, so candidates must have the legal ability to work throughout the program.
